Environmental justice is crucial here. Many LGBTQ+ individuals experience homelessness and lack access to green spaces. This exacerbates existing health disparities. Climate change further impacts vulnerable populations, including LGBTQ+ people. Discussions often involve intersectionality – exploring overlapping forms of marginalization. Understanding environmental ethics within this context is essential for creating inclusive, sustainable communities. Learn more about how environmental ethics informs LGBTQ+ rights advocacy.
